Moon Palace is a huge resort with 3 distinct sections: Sunrise, Nizuc (which means sunset), and Grand. Sunrise is the biggest and has the most activities. The pool area has multiple pools, restaurants and bars, a surfing simulator, music, games and more. Inside the lobby there are escalators (which I've never seen at a resort like this), restaurants, lounges, a teens club with billiards, air hockey, video games and more, a great nightclub (Noir). Nizuc has a quieter feel, though it is still quite large with plenty to do. The lobby is stunning! The attention to detail in the decor amazed me as we walked through here. The Grand section is a great place to get away from all of the activity. It's a bit smaller (for now) without the loud music and activities. A great place to get away and read a book or soak in the sun. The standard rooms here are bigger than the other sections of the resort - and quite beautiful. Enjoy a drink and some sushi on the rooftop bar in the evening - pure heaven!
